Xinhai Revolution photograph

Xinhai Revolution

Use attributes for filter !
Locations China
Awards Hundred Flowers Award for Best Supporting Actor
Hundred Flowers Award for Best Supporting Actress
Date of Reg.
Date of Upd.
ID732458
Send edit request

About Xinhai Revolution


The Xinhai Revolution, also known as the Chinese Revolution or the Revolution of 1911, was a revolution that overthrew China's last imperial dynasty and established the Republic of China.

Xinhai Revolution Photos

Related Persons

Next Profile ❯